Location: Baker City, Eastern Oregon, Oregon, USA (9 Miles from Historic Baker City at the Base of the Elkhorns)
Accommodations: House on Acreage, 3 Bedrooms + Loft, 2.5 Baths (Sleeps 8-10)
Austin House sits on 10 acres and includes a seasonal stocked lake, corrals for horses, and a 1500 square foot shop converted to a old west style party room. French doors open to outdoor seating along the seasonal lake with fire pits and barbecue. Pastures and hay are available for horses. The oversized kitchen features a wood cook stove, 6 burner gas range with oven, microwave and wall mount electric oven for food preparation for large groups. Both house and shop have large refrigerators for beverage and food storage.
This 1970's custom built home is filled with antiques and family heirlooms. Modern updates give you that feeling of luxury and comfort. The large parking area can accommodate large trailers and RV's. There are plenty of sites along the lake in the trees for additional tent camping. Outside toilets are available for campers. For more information, contact owners.
